Category 1: The Professional 12-Volt Base System
The Storm begins with a 12-volt pump delivering 5.3 GPM at 100 PSI (actual delivery is lower at the tip), providing 35–40 ft of reach—enough for siding, roofs, and most two-story jobs. Built on a lifetime-warranty aircraft aluminum frame, with double-thick chemical tanks, this system is made for durability, portability, and professional performance.
Control Panel & Metering System
-
-
Bleach Valve (metering): Adjusts from 0–5% Sodium Hypochlorite output. Since most 12.5% bleach degrades to ~10% by the time it reaches contractors, the valve is marked on a “1–5” scale. A Bleach Settings chart on the panel shows recommended concentrations for different applications.
-
Soap Valve (metering): Measures in ounces per gallon, with a “1–5” range. At max setting (5 oz/gal), you’ll have extreme foam—rarely needed except for degreasing. Allows pretreatments such as turning bleach off and running only soap or degreaser via the draw tube.
-
Water Valve (on/off): Simple two-position valve—restricted (50%) for spraying chemicals and open (100%) for flushing at night. Vertical = On, Horizontal = Off.

Power Source: Requires a Group 24 marine deep-cycle DC battery (not included). Must NOT be a starting battery.
Pump, Tanks & Plumbing
-
Pump: Easily swapped out in under 10 minutes in the field.
-
Draw Tube (stinger): Includes its own on/off valve and hand primer bulb—pulls chemical into the line faster, saving setup time (especially useful as pumps age).
-
Buffer Tank: 8-gallon water buffer with Hudson float valve for steady supply.
-
Bleach Tank: 50-gallon SH tank with double-seal insert to prevent splashback and protect lid seals from premature wear.
-
Plumbing: Polypropylene throughout, fully chemical-resistant.
Hose, Reel & Gun
-
Reel: Stingray™ U-Frame reel with 12” spool (slimline design for compact fit). Holds up to 200 ft of ½-inch hose. Lifetime warranty on reel body, swivel, and manifold. OPTIONAL 12\\” electric reel is available.
-
Hose: High-quality clear hose to visually monitor flow; stays flexible in cold weather (35–45°F). Reverse hose every 12 months for extended life.
-
Gun: Purpose-built soft wash gun designed for easy field repair. On/Off valve replaces a traditional trigger for reliability.
-
Quick Connects: Brass with stainless steel ball bearings; clean up easily if corroded. Replaceable o-rings for long service life.
-
Six Shooter Tip Cartridge: Carries up to 6 tips at once with a lanyard to prevent loss.
-
Included Tips: Size 20 orifice with 40° pattern and Size 20 orifice with 0° pattern (direct shoot).

Category 3: Pure Water Window Cleaning & Auto Detailing
Take your Storm to the next level with Module 3, a complete, premium pure water delivery system designed for glass cleaning and detailing work. Built with a 4-stage filtration system, this module ensures spot-free results on windows, vehicles, and other delicate surfaces.
-
Stage 1: Sediment filter 2.5\\” Diameter x 10\\” length size – catches the larger physical particles in the water before it goes to the other filters
-
Stage 2: Carbon filter 2.5\\” Diameter x 10\\” length size – removes chlorine and contaminants and helps protect the RO membrane
-
Stage 3: Reverse Osmosis (RO) membranes 20\\” length size, encased in stainless steel housing- for high-efficiency purification and handles the lion’s share of the water purification process
-
Stage 4: Deionization (DI) polishing filter 4.5\\” Diameter x 10\\” length size – for ultra-pure, streak-free water, finishes off the final process
Includes a 12\\” U-Frame hose reel that holds 200 ft of 3/8\\” clear hose and a 50 gallon pure water, double insulated storage holding tank for pure water storage.
Has a built-in TDS meter and a pump speed controller for controlling the amount of water being sent. This comes in handy for determining the amount of water based on the application: spraying or water fed pole cleaning.
The system has a control valve that allows the operator to either fill, spray or fill+spray. As a standalone unit (not connected to Cat 1 or 2) it has a standard garden hose connector for the source water. It can also be modularly attached to the other Storm Cat systems for water draw.
The system supports up to 2 simultaneous users with approximately 5 GPM pump.
